Things that make you think of a name and an occupation... The first one came up at work today and got me thinking.

Bootlace Ferrule (the famous country & western singer)
Bentley Clutchplate (Lieutenant-Commander, R.N. (Retd.))


The index of Gray's Anatomy (the medical text) seems to be a rich vein (sorry  ::-))...

Deltoid Ligament (champion bodybuilder)
The Ilio-tibial Band (you remember them from the 60s?)
Impressio Colica (Italian tenor, initially sounds good but eventually gives you indigestion)
and so on...

Any more for any more?

Alan Coren did an article about this, based on the contents of each volume of the Encyclopaedia Britannica (it was in "The Sanity Inspector".  Hence "Cocker Dias" was an East End flyweight boxer, "Jirasek Lighthouses" a Czech film director, "Vietnam Zworkin" an American radical feminist and so on.
